What's Happening?
The Arizona Diamondbacks clinched a series victory against the Philadelphia Phillies with a 4-3 win, despite facing significant challenges. The team has been dealing with a tough schedule and multiple injuries, including their ace pitcher and key outfielders.
Despite these setbacks, the Diamondbacks have managed to win nine of their last 13 games, holding a 9-7 record. In the latest game, the Phillies had opportunities to score but failed to capitalize, allowing the Diamondbacks to secure the win. Arizona's performance on their current road trip has been strong, with a 4-2 record so far, including series wins over the Mets and Phillies.
